Injury recovered, Gregoria is set to appear in the Malaysia Open 2021

Jakarta (medialnews) – After missing several European tournaments in March due to an injury to the right thigh, women’s national badminton player Gregoria Mariska Tunjung admitted she was ready to return to compete in the competition.

Gregoria plans to participate in the BWF Super 750 tournament on May 25-30 in Kuala Lumpur, a qualifying tournament for the Tokyo Olympics.

“Praise God I’m healthy, I’m fine, I’m 100 percent recovered. Now I’m preparing to go to Malaysia. It’s been pretty good, especially in the past three weeks, I’ve been physically trained by my coach,” and now I feel fitter, ”he said. Gregoria, according to PP PBSI’s official statement, Friday.

In addition to being physically trained, his training also focuses on increasing focus during competitions. He admits that he often loses focus, especially on critical points.

“Time to compete is not only physical, but there are many factors such as mental readiness and others. That’s why I’m also trying to increase my focus on the field, which was one of the obstacles,” he said.

In Malaysia, Gregoria is determined to perform at its best to improve the standings ahead of the Tokyo Olympics. The calculations did not qualify for him, but he still had the chance to win one ticket.

In addition to Gregoria, the Indonesian team sent eleven other representatives, plus a joint Malay / Indonesian pair.

Men’s Singles: Jonatan Christie, Anthony Sinisuka Ginting, Tommy Sugiarto

Women’s singles: Gregoria Mariska Tunjung

Men’s Doubles: Marcus Fernaldi Gideon / Kevin Sanjaya Sukamuljo, Fajar Alfian / Muhammad Rian Ardianto, Mohammad Ahsan / Hendra Setiawan

Women’s Doubles: Greysia Polii / Apriyani Rahayu, Siti Fadia Silva Ramadhanti / Ribka Sugiarto

Mixed doubles: Praveen Jordan / Melati Daeva Oktavianti, Hafiz Faizal / Gloria Emanuelle Widjaja, Adnan Maulana / Mychelle Crhystine Bandaso, Mohamad Arif Ab Latif / Rusydina Antardayu Riodingin.
